Conjugate verb "profilare" in Italian

Conjugation of the verb profilare, 1st conjugation     translation to English profile
Auxiliary: avere

All formsIndicativo Conjuntivo Condizionale Imperativo Forme Impersonali

Indicativo

Presente

io profilo
tu profili
lui/lei profila
noi profiliamo
voi profilate
loro profilano

Passato Prossimo

io ho profilato
tu hai profilato
lui/lei ha profilato
noi abbiamo profilato
voi avete profilato
loro hanno profilato

Imperfetto

io profilavo
tu profilavi
lui/lei profilava
noi profilavamo
voi profilavate
loro profilavano

Trapassato Prossimo

io avevo profilato
tu avevi profilato
lui/lei aveva profilato
noi avevamo profilato
voi avevate profilato
loro avevano profilato

Futuro

io profilerò
tu profilerai
lui/lei profilerà
noi profileremo
voi profilerete
loro profileranno

Futuro Anteriore

io avrò profilato
tu avrai profilato
lui/lei avrà profilato
noi avremo profilato
voi avrete profilato
loro avranno profilato

Passato Remoto

io profilai
tu profilasti
lui/lei profilò
noi profilammo
voi profilaste
loro profilarono

Trapassato Remoto

io ebbi profilato
tu avesti profilato
lui/lei ebbe profilato
noi avemmo profilato
voi aveste profilato
loro ebbero profilato

Conjuntivo

Presente

io profili
tu profili
lui/lei profili
noi profiliamo
voi profiliate
loro profilino

Passato Prossimo

io abbia profilato
tu abbia profilato
lui/lei abbia profilato
noi abbiamo profilato
voi abbiate profilato
loro abbiano profilato

Imperfetto

io profilassi
tu profilassi
lui/lei profilasse
noi profilassimo
voi profilaste
loro profilassero

Trapassato Prossimo

io avessi profilato
tu avessi profilato
lui/lei avesse profilato
noi avessimo profilato
voi aveste profilato
loro avessero profilato

Condizionale

Presente

io profilerei
tu profileresti
lui/lei profilerebbe
noi profileremmo
voi profilereste
loro profilerebbero

Passato

io avrei profilato
tu avresti profilato
lui/lei avrebbe profilato
noi avremmo profilato
voi avreste profilato
loro avrebbero profilato

Imperativo

(tu) profila (Lei) profili (noi) profiliamo (voi) profilate (Loro) profilino

Forme Impersonali

Participio Presente

Singular Plural
Masculino profilante profilanti
Femenino profilante profilanti

Participio Passato

Singular Plural
Masculino profilato profilati
Femenino profilata profilate

Gerundio Presente

profilando

Gerundio Passato

avendo profilato

Italian Nouns and Adjectives

In Italian, nouns can be masculine or feminine, and adjectives match nouns in number and gender. For example, "un libro interessante" (an interesting book) and "due libri interessanti" (two interesting books).
